Thomas Jefferson was Amer¬ica’s third president. He wrote most of the Declaration of Inde¬pendence, which led to the inde¬pendence of our country. He led to the expansion of our country through the Louisiana Purchase. His vision was to expand the U.S. across the entire North American continent.
